Synchronization Concept:



So far, we are assuming that there is no propagation delay and/or other processing delays incurred between the transmitter and the receiver input.

Therefore, the code copy used at the receiver is perfectly lined-up with the initial code used at the transmitter. These two codes are said to be in phase or in sync. (Synchronization).
